No Fuel cells, fuel tanks, etc. allowed on the front weight bar, bumper etc. in the 2.6 class. Fuel tank must be in the OEM locations or in a racing type fuel cell properly secured in the bed of the truck. The updated rules should be posted by the end of this week. This has been the rule for the last few seasons.

Caleb, he's saying it's unclear because it wasn't written into anyone's 2012 rules.
I don't think it's right to have rules that exist outside of the rulebook, but it happens often. It would take 5 minutes to put it up as an addendum on the web site, or post it here, etc.
Rawdog is right, if you live far away and don't come to the rules meetings and/or don't ask someone, you could show up with a truck that meets the printed rules but would get flak from tech at the first pull it went to.
